LaMark Carter
LaMark Carter (born 23 August 1970 in Shreveport, Louisiana) is a retired American triple jumper.
His personal best was 17.44 metres, achieved in June 1998 in New Orleans. He made the USA Olympic Team in 2000 but did not medal in the Sydney Games.
At the US 2004 Olympic Team Trials he tested positive for the banned substance salbutamol.[1]
